多云主机文件共享的简易方案
在多云环境下,构建可靠的共享文件系统是许多开发者的共同需求。本文将介绍一种简单、可靠且易于部署的解决方案,满足多云主机间共享目录文件的需求,并支持Go或python开发。
文章探讨了在多台云主机上共享目录文件,并兼顾稳定性和易部署性的方法。提问者曾考虑FastDFS,但最终选择了更便捷的方案。
考虑到性能要求不高,更注重稳定性和易部署性,建议使用NFS (Network File System) 。NFS是一个成熟稳定的分布式文件系统,允许多台客户端共享同一服务器上的文件。大多数操作系统都原生支持NFS客户端和服务器,简化了部署过程。 通过配置NFS服务器和客户端,即可轻松实现文件共享,无需学习和部署复杂的分布式存储系统。
虽然一些教程(此处略去)详细介绍了NFS的部署步骤,但理解NFS的核心概念和基本配置步骤是关键。 通过简单的配置,即可在多云主机上实现共享目录。
Go和Python无需依赖专门的NFS SDK,可以直接使用操作系统提供的接口操作挂载的NFS共享目录,进行文件读写操作。 这只需要掌握基本的系统命令和编程语言的I/O操作即可。
© 版权声明
文章版权归作者所有,未经允许请勿转载。
THE END